Fuzzy resource-constrained project scheduling with multiple routes: A heuristic solution

被引:36
作者
Birjandi, Alireza [1 ]
Mousavi, S. Meysam [2 ]
机构
[1] Islamic Azad Univ, South Tehran Branch, Dept Ind Engn, Tehran, Iran
[2] Shahed Univ, Dept Ind Engn, Fac Engn, Tehran, Iran
关键词
Resource-constrained project scheduling problem (RCPSP); Trapezoidal fuzzy numbers; Multiple routes; Uncertainty; Distribution rules; PSO; GA; CRITICAL PATH; MATHEMATICAL-MODELS; ALGORITHM; RCPSP; SOLVE; SELECTION;
D O I
10.1016/j.autcon.2018.11.029
中图分类号
TU [建筑科学];
学科分类号
0813 ;
摘要
The resource-constrained project scheduling problem (RCPSP) with multiple routes by considering flexible activities is one of important subjects in project scheduling problems. The ability to select an appropriate route for implementing the flexible activities is a rational reason for indicating more complexity of the problem relative to common RCPSP that attracted the attention of the researchers in the recent decade. On the other hand, due to lack of access to project crisp information, the needs to consider uncertainty concepts in the RCPSP will be significant. Hence, in this paper, a new fuzzy mixed integer nonlinear programming (MINLP) model is presented under uncertain conditions. A hybrid meta-heuristic approach is also proposed to minimize costs of project completion. In this approach, to generate high quality initial solutions, a heuristic algorithm is designed based on distribution rules. Then, to change and assign an appropriate route from available routes for flexible activities, a meta-heuristic algorithm is presented based on binary particle swarm optimization (PSO). Finally, to generate best solution from routes assigned by the binary PSO, a meta-heuristic based on genetic algorithm (GA) is proposed. To appraise the effectiveness of presented model, different test problems are solved by the proposed approach, and comparisons are provided with results obtained by the GA and PSO.
引用
收藏
页码:84 / 102
页数:19
相关论文
共 61 条
  • [1] [Anonymous], J SCHEDULING
  • [2] [Anonymous], 2015, Op. Res. Appl.: Int. J
  • [3] A heuristic method for RCPSP with fuzzy activity times
    Bhaskar, Tarun
    Pal, Manabendra N.
    Pal, Asim K.
    [J]. EUROPEAN JOURNAL OF OPERATIONAL RESEARCH, 2011, 208 (01) : 57 - 66
  • [4] Construction Project Scheduling with Time, Cost, and Material Restrictions Using Fuzzy Mathematical Models and Critical Path Method
    Castro-Lacouture, Daniel
    Suer, Gursel A.
    Gonzalez-Joaqui, Julian
    Yates, J. K.
    [J]. JOURNAL OF CONSTRUCTION ENGINEERING AND MANAGEMENT, 2009, 135 (10) : 1096 - 1104
  • [5] Resource constrained project scheduling with uncertain activity durations
    Chakrabortty, Ripon K.
    Sarker, Ruhul A.
    Essam, Daryl L.
    [J]. COMPUTERS & INDUSTRIAL ENGINEERING, 2017, 112 : 537 - 550
  • [6] Multi-mode resource constrained project scheduling under resource disruptions
    Chakrabortty, Ripon K.
    Sarker, Ruhul A.
    Essam, Daryl L.
    [J]. COMPUTERS & CHEMICAL ENGINEERING, 2016, 88 : 13 - 29
  • [7] On the use of genetic programming to evolve priority rules for resource constrained project scheduling problems
    Chand, Shelvin
    Quang Huynh
    Singh, Hemant
    Ray, Tapabrata
    Wagner, Markus
    [J]. INFORMATION SCIENCES, 2018, 432 : 146 - 163
  • [8] Using a fuzzy clustering chaotic-based differential evolution with serial method to solve resource-constrained project scheduling problems
    Cheng, Min-Yuan
    Duc-Hoc Tran
    Wu, Yu-Wei
    [J]. AUTOMATION IN CONSTRUCTION, 2014, 37 : 88 - 97
  • [9] An exact composite lower bound strategy for the resource-constrained project scheduling problem
    Coelho, Jose
    Vanhoucke, Mario
    [J]. COMPUTERS & OPERATIONS RESEARCH, 2018, 93 : 135 - 150
  • [10] Conway R.W., 2003, Theory of scheduling